  5. Only thing to add here is.... Set up Naming rules early and not often. We use 3 (0xx) digit prefix so that similar symbol group together even if not in folders. Mostly as our job numbers are 3 digits so project specific symbols have job code as a prefix. To keep library file smaller and fast we break up libraries by first 2 digits. However the important thing is to have a naming system, but it only needs to be as complex suits your workflow. If you don't then people don't feel like they can find what they need and will keep just going back to last time.

  10. Well not just walls, roofs and slabs would all benefit from having components that understand they are frames not panels of solid material. Roofs have rafters, hips, valleys, barges,.... and facias that could all be made with a Framed Component. Slabs have edge and other beams that could all be made with a Framed Component(s). These two would help us get to convincing large scale sections in minutes not hours. So to me, it's not just a super wall but a superstructure inside all our building elements.
